Argentina fielded six competitors at the 2009 World Championships in Athletics in Berlin.[1]

Results
Men
- Track and road events
| Event | Athletes | Final |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Result | Rank | ||
| 20 km walk | Juan Manuel Cano | 1:29:20 SB | 40 |
- Field and combined events
| Event | Athletes | Qualification | Final |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Result | Rank | Result | Rank | ||
| Shot put | Germán Lauro | NM | - | did not advance | |
| Discus throw | Jorge Balliengo | 59.19 | 23 | did not advance | |
| Germán Lauro | 57.88 | 28 | did not advance | ||
| Hammer throw | Juan Ignacio Cerra | 69.37 | 30 | did not advance | |
Women
- Field and combined events
| Event | Athletes | Qualification | Final |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Result | Rank | Result | Rank | ||
| Discus throw | Rocío Comba | 54.69 | 30 | did not advance | |
| Hammer throw | Jennifer Dahlgren | 68.90 | 17 | did not advance | |
